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) for Physical Education

SAMS stands for Students Academic Management System. It has two components e-Admission & e-Administration. SAMS presently supports online admission for Higher Secondary, Degree, Post-graduations, ITI, Diploma, PDIS, Teacher Education, Physical Education, correspondence and Music, Dance & Drama Education institutions.
e-Admission is nothing but online admission carried out for various courses (as answered in the ques-1) of Odisha. The detailed process of admission is explained in the Common Prospectus (CP) available separately for different courses.

An applicant has to choose 2 nos. of Govt. College of Physical Educations (GCPE) for B.P.Ed. Course & for M.P.Ed. Course there is only one option available.
An option is a combination of a particular GCPE for B.P.Ed & for M.P.Ed.course. You should exercise your options in order of preference only i.e. the most preferred option to be opted first.
No. The selection will be conducted on the basis of merit, reservations & Physical Fitness Test. Student will be selected against any one option only.
Multiple choice of preference is much needed because, the selection will be done on merit basis. For example, if you apply with two preferences and you get selected against the 2nd option, then your status for 1st option is open in subsequent rounds. You can pay your CAF Fees Rs.200/- (Non-refundable) irrespective of category per application.
An applicant can modify the provided information by student's login through the SAMS student e-Space till submission of the CAF online. After submission of the same, applicant will be able to modify the CAF, until depositing of the CAF fees through online mode. After payment made successful through online, CAF information can't be modified.

After getting your Index Card you are required for validation & Physical Fitness Test at Kalinga Stadium Warm-up practice field (running).
List of the documents required is given in the Intimation Letter. Arrange all the requisites for admission such as original certificates for verification, CAF print-out copy, passport s ize photo, admission fees & report to the Principal of the destination college on the scheduled date & time.
Admission will be completed in three steps: i.e. First Selection, Second Selection & Third selection (If vacancy arises) for the applicants
